Understanding Your Resting ECG: What Findings Mean

A typical resting electrocardiogram, or ECG, records the electrical activity while you're still. Reviewing your report can feel overwhelming , but generally it provides valuable information about your heart health . Specific patterns, like deviations in the heart rate or the indication of T-wave inversion , can point to potential problems , such as heart disease. However, many changes on an ECG are harmless and won’t further investigation . Be sure to discuss your full ECG results with your physician for personalized assessment and guidance .

Holter EKG Recording: A Comprehensive Guide to Heart Beat Assessment

Holter EKG assessment provides a extended evaluation of your heart’s rhythm, typically over 24 to 48 days. As opposed to a standard EKG, which captures only a brief moment in time, a Holter device continuously documents your heart’s electrical performance. This is especially beneficial for identifying infrequent arrhythmias that a single ECG might overlook. During the monitoring time, you’ll be asked to keep a note of any symptoms, such as fluttering, allowing your cardiologist to correlate these events with the recorded data.

Here's what's involved:

  • Getting Ready: Guidelines will be given regarding what to avoid before the test.
  • Attachment: Small sensors are attached to your body with adhesive.
  • Data Collection: The device continuously records your cardiac pulse.
  • Experience Documentation: Meticulously record any symptoms.
  • Examination: Your physician will analyze the captured readings.

Knowing the process and accurately reporting your symptoms are critical for an precise assessment.
